logo

Output 268062b4bdabb77e8b8961838a24eed249ee181122083bdb9a4ded2af056caf7:0

value
939601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5fee22f0a3b7508a2d4a38f487e21922f384479 OP_EQUAL
address
3Nf816EdEe8wXEMcHALjhpK31K6ezrcTYC
transaction
268062b4bdabb77e8b8961838a24eed249ee181122083bdb9a4ded2af056caf7